Special Recruitment Drive for SC/ST/OBC-NCL/EWS/PwBD for Faculty Positions in Chemistry

Position Description:

IIT Guwahati invites applications from individuals who belong to SC/ST/OBC-NCL/EWS/PwBD categories for faculty positions at the level of Assistant Professor (Grade I/II) in various Departments/Schools.

Required Qualification:

Essential Qualification:

  • Ph.D. with first class or equivalent in the preceding degree in an appropriate branch with a very good academic record throughout.
  • Must possess a Bachelor’s degree and a Master’s degree or a 5-year integrated Master’s degree in Chemistry / Chemical Science and Technology.

Preferred Qualification:

Assistant Professor Grade II (7th CPC Pay level 10 & 11):
  • Candidates with less than three years of post-Ph.D. teaching/research/industrial experience may be considered for this post.
Assistant Professor Grade I (7th CPC Pay level 12):
  • Candidates with at least 3 years of post-PhD teaching/research/industrial experience may be considered for this post.

About the Host Institution:

The Indian Institute of Technology (IIT) Guwahati, established in 1994, is a prestigious public technical university in India, offering engineering, science, and humanities programs with strong research focus, recognized as an Institute of National Importance, known for its modern infrastructure, vibrant campus life, and significant national and global rankings in engineering and research. It's part of the elite IIT system, situated on the Brahmaputra's north bank, providing bachelor's, master's, and doctoral degrees.
